Abstract

One in seven people in the world have some kind of disability. In Brazil, conservative Census estimates point to more than 13 million people with physical disabilities. In addition, there are around 30 million elderly people in the country, 14 million children between 0 and 4 years of age and 2.5 million pregnant women, who can also be seen as "people with limited mobility". For these people, their friends and family, everyday acts like leaving home can pose major challenges due to the lack of accessibility in places and venues.Focusing on this issue, guiaderodas was created, an accessibility company with three major focal points: Cause, Services and Technology. Firstly, the guiaderodas initiative aims to raise public awareness about the issue of accessibility, showing that everyone needed, need or will need accessibility one day, either by a permanent condition or by a temporary event (such as a broken leg example). In addition, as a first result of technological research, a geolocation-based collaborative application has been published. In this crowdsourcing platform, disabled and non-disabled users can give their opinion about the accessibility of any venue through a quick and simplified assessment. The application also supports searches and queries, serving as a handy tool for people with limited mobility to safely plan their outings.Financial sustainability comes from the sales of consulting services for companies and buildings. These services go beyond the architectural analysis based on laws and norms, also evaluating aspects of functionality and usability of the spaces, as well as providing attitudinal training for customer service improvement. However, demand increase leads to growth difficulties inherent to consulting services.In order to expand its operations, the goal is to increase the scalability of the products and services resulting from innovation research works carried out so far, so that they can serve the big market. For the mobile app, it is planned to extend its functionalities, consolidating it as the "Platform of the person with limited mobility", aggregating relevant contents and news and encouraging collaboration through "positive competition", through the adoption of elements of gamification. For the Services, this is done by creating a simplified technology-based assessment, lowering its costs and opening up job opportunities: on-site visits are carried out by users of the application, always wheelchair users, hired and paid for each visit. Thus, the model also serves as a source of extra income and a channel for using these people's practical knowledge for the sake of improving accessibility throughout the country.The experience of wheelchair users and people with disabilities is valued by financially compensating them. Thus, guiaderodas is able to provide a useful product for venues and establishments and maximize its social impact, by transforming "disabilities" into virtues. By improving the mobile app, it becomes more attractive, engaging and useful, as well as opening up new possibilities for creating revenue streams. (AU)
